目录导读
- OpenClaw常见故障类型全解析
- 五大核心故障诊断步骤详解
- 连接类问题排查与解决方案
- 功能异常问题深度处理方法
- 性能优化与预防性维护策略
- 专家问答:高频故障实战解答
OpenClaw常见故障类型全解析
OpenClaw作为一款功能强大的自动化控制软件,在实际应用中可能遇到多种类型的故障,根据cm-openclaw.com.cn技术团队收集的数据,最常见的故障可以分为三大类别:连接类故障、功能执行类故障和系统性能类故障,连接问题约占故障总量的45%,通常表现为设备无法识别、通信中断或协议不匹配;功能异常约占35%,包括脚本执行错误、动作执行偏差等;性能问题约占20%,主要表现为响应延迟、资源占用过高等情况。

深入分析发现,80%的故障并非由软件本身缺陷引起,而是由于配置不当、环境不兼容或操作失误导致,掌握正确的故障诊断思路比盲目尝试修复更为重要,用户可通过访问OpenClaw下载页面获取最新稳定版本,许多已知问题在新版本中已得到修复。
五大核心故障诊断步骤详解
第一步:现象精准记录与重现 当故障发生时,首先需要详细记录故障发生的具体现象、时间和操作步骤,尽可能精确地重现故障场景,记录软件版本号、操作系统信息、硬件配置等关键数据,cm-openclaw.com.cn技术支持团队建议用户开启软件日志功能,这些日志文件对于后续诊断至关重要。
第二步:基础环境检查 检查计算机基础运行环境是否满足OpenClaw的最低要求,包括操作系统版本、.NET Framework版本、可用磁盘空间和内存资源,同时确认是否有安全软件或防火墙阻断了OpenClaw的正常运行。
第三步:配置验证 仔细检查项目配置文件、设备连接参数、脚本逻辑等设置是否正确,据统计,约30%的“故障”实际上是配置参数填写错误导致的。
第四步:隔离测试 通过简化测试环境,逐步排除干扰因素,可以先创建一个最小测试项目,验证基本功能是否正常,再逐步添加复杂组件,定位问题出现的具体环节。
第五步:日志分析与求助 分析OpenClaw生成的运行日志、错误日志和调试信息,如果自行无法解决,可将这些日志与详细描述一起提交到cm-openclaw.com.cn技术支持平台。
连接类问题排查与解决方案
设备无法识别问题 当OpenClaw无法识别连接的硬件设备时,首先检查物理连接是否牢固,USB端口或串口是否正常工作,接着确认设备驱动程序是否已正确安装,在设备管理器中查看设备状态,对于网络设备,需确保IP地址设置正确,网络防火墙未阻止相关端口通信。
通信协议错误处理 如果设备能够识别但通信失败,重点检查协议设置,确认选择的通信协议与设备实际支持的协议一致,检查波特率、数据位、停止位和校验位等参数是否匹配,对于Modbus、OPC UA等工业协议,还需要检查从站地址、寄存器地址等参数设置是否正确。
间歇性连接断开解决方案 这类问题通常与环境干扰、电源不稳定或线缆质量有关,建议使用屏蔽线缆,为设备配置稳定的电源,并远离强电磁干扰源,同时检查软件中的心跳包设置和超时重连机制是否配置合理。
功能异常问题深度处理方法
脚本执行错误调试 OpenClaw的脚本执行错误通常由语法错误、逻辑错误或资源访问冲突引起,软件内置的脚本编辑器提供语法高亮和基础错误检查功能,应充分利用,对于复杂逻辑错误,可采用分段调试法,在关键位置添加日志输出,逐步缩小问题范围。
动作执行偏差校正 当机械臂或执行机构的动作与预期不符时,首先校准零点位置和各个关节的坐标系,检查运动参数设置,包括加速度、减速度、最大速度等是否在设备允许范围内,对于重复定位精度问题,可能需要进行反向间隙补偿和负载补偿参数调整。
传感器数据异常处理 传感器数据异常可能源于传感器本身故障、信号干扰或数据处理算法问题,建议先使用独立的测试工具验证传感器输出是否正常,再检查OpenClaw中的信号滤波参数和数据解析算法,对于模拟量传感器,还需检查AD转换模块的精度和采样频率设置。
性能优化与预防性维护策略
系统资源优化配置 OpenClaw运行时若出现响应迟缓或卡顿,可从以下几个方面优化:调整软件进程优先级,合理分配CPU核心资源;优化脚本执行效率,避免循环中的冗余计算;定期清理临时文件和缓存数据;确保硬件满足或超过软件推荐配置。
定期维护计划实施 建立预防性维护计划可大幅降低故障发生率,cm-openclaw.com.cn专家建议每周检查一次系统日志中的警告信息;每月备份一次项目配置和重要脚本;每季度全面检查硬件连接和机械部件磨损情况;每年对系统进行深度优化和升级。
灾难恢复方案准备 为关键应用场景准备完整的灾难恢复方案,包括:定期全系统备份策略、快速恢复操作流程、备用硬件设备清单、紧急情况联系人列表等,确保在cm-openclaw.com.cn账户中保存最新版的软件安装包和驱动程序。
专家问答:高频故障实战解答
问:OpenClaw启动时提示“许可证无效或已过期”怎么办? 答:此问题通常由许可证文件损坏或系统时间异常引起,首先检查计算机系统日期和时间是否正确;然后到cm-openclaw.com.cn账户中重新下载许可证文件;如果问题依旧,联系技术支持重新生成许可证,临时解决方案是使用试用模式,但功能可能受限。
问:如何解决OpenClaw与第三方软件的数据交换问题? 答:数据交换故障通常由接口协议不匹配或数据格式不一致导致,首先确认双方软件支持的接口类型(如DDE、OPC、API等);检查数据格式、类型和单位是否一致;对于实时数据交换,还需确认更新频率设置是否匹配,建议参考官方文档中的集成示例进行配置。
问:OpenClaw脚本运行一段时间后自动停止,没有任何错误提示,如何排查? 答:这种“静默失败”通常由资源泄漏或隐式异常导致,启用详细调试日志记录;在脚本中添加异常捕获和记录机制;监控系统资源使用情况,特别是内存和句柄数量;检查是否有外部进程干扰,复杂脚本建议拆分为多个模块,便于隔离问题。
问:升级OpenClaw后原有项目无法正常运行,该如何处理? 答:版本兼容性问题可尝试以下解决方案:首先检查官方发布的版本变更说明,了解不兼容改动;使用项目迁移工具(如有);逐步将原有配置导入新版本项目,而非直接打开;保留旧版本软件和项目备份以便回退,建议在非生产环境中先完成升级测试。
通过系统性地应用本文介绍的故障解决方法,绝大多数OpenClaw运行问题都能得到有效解决,定期访问OpenClaw下载页面获取更新和补丁,参与用户社区讨论,将帮助您更好地预防和应对各种运行挑战,建立完整的故障处理文档记录,不仅能加速未来问题的解决,也能为团队知识积累提供宝贵资源。